Output 84382ea2c244f29882853c668ab1b43dd3a507731138379cc6fa68cb3a0db030:21

value
28605000
script pubkey
OP_0 OP_PUSHBYTES_20 34ad7a73338e82a000e3ab38276b1289d9417500
address
bc1qxjkh5uen36p2qq8r4vuzw6cj38v5zagqzepzd2
transaction
84382ea2c244f29882853c668ab1b43dd3a507731138379cc6fa68cb3a0db030